A SNAPSHOT OF THE CUSTOMER & SALES SUPPORT ADMINISTRATORS DAY...

You will support the Sales Team to assist them in the day-to-day administration of their customers accounts. Provide excellent Customer Service to ensure that the retention of customers is a priority within all aspects of the role.

  • Support the sales team to assist in all day-to-day administration of their customer accounts, carrying out large volumes of written client correspondence and general data tasks
  • Provide excellent customer service to ensure that the retention of customers is priority again 80% of correspondence via written methods, email etc
  • Take incoming calls relating to orders, investigating any queries and providing written responses within an agreed timeframe
  • Check and monitor the sales email inbox and online sales orders, actioning orders to the correct cost centre and correct service provider
  • Update systems, maintain customer data and sales activity information, reporting and sending to customers when requested
  • Input all orders daily, ensuring they are on the system ready for despatch in a timely manner and provide order confirmation to the customer.
  • Assist with resolution of customer enquires or complaints
  • Assist with written quotations to customers
